Why the “bonus” is really just a mathematical trap

Most operators parade a bitcoin casino deposit bonus like it’s a free ticket out of the rat race. In reality it’s a carefully calibrated piece of arithmetic designed to keep you playing long enough to offset the tiny edge they already own. Take a look at how Bet365 structures its welcome offer: you deposit 0.5 BTC, they match 100% up to 0.1 BTC, but every wager must rollover ten times before you can cash out. Ten times. That’s not a gift, it’s a grinding treadmill wrapped in glitter.

And because crypto transactions are irreversible, you cannot simply pull the plug if the terms become unbearable. The casino’s “VIP” status turns out to be a cheap motel with a fresh coat of paint – you’re still paying for the same leaky faucet, just under a better name.

The hidden costs lurking behind the glossy banner

First, the conversion rate. When you convert fiat to bitcoin, you’re already paying a spread. Then the casino adds a “0.5% cash‑out fee” that looks innocuous until you try to extract the bonus winnings. The fee is applied to the whole withdrawal, not just the bonus portion, effectively eroding any perceived advantage.

Second, the wagering requirements often come with game restrictions. Slots like Starburst or Gonzo’s Quest may look tempting, but they’re excluded from the rollover count because their volatility is too high. That forces you onto low‑variance table games where the casino’s edge is a smidge larger than on the slots you’d rather spin.

What the numbers actually say – a quick rundown

  • Deposit 0.3 BTC, receive 0.15 BTC bonus (50% match)
  • Wagering requirement: 8× bonus + deposit = 2.4 BTC
  • Average house edge on eligible games: 1.5 %
  • Effective loss before cash‑out: roughly 0.036 BTC

If you’re the type who thinks “just one more spin” will flip the odds, you’ll soon discover that the house edge compounds faster than a roulette wheel on a speed‑run. Even the most generous promotional “gift” is dwarfed by the inevitable statistical grind.
